The director shall mark all game farms, state game refuges, game or fish management areas, breeding grounds, and resting places under the director's protection. No person may mutilate, destroy, tear or pull down, or shoot at any designating mark or other special or general warning sign or card.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- North Dakota Century Code Title 20.1. Game, Fish, Predators, and Boating § 20.1-11-10.
